| In fact Mergs' statement about it being the reason for agriculture has more validity than he probably thinks. My World Civ book (and my World Civ Professor) says that while humans love grain for making things like bread and oatmeal, it was probably the fact that grain could be used to make beer that encouraged the agricultural revolution.
